MA in Drama and Performing Arts in Education and Lifelong Learning

One of the MA programs offered by the Department of Theatre Studies (University of the Peloponnese) is titled "MA in Drama and Performing Arts in Education and Lifelong Learning" (DPAELL). Its issue of interest lies within the study, promotion and transmission of knowledge related to drama in education and the performing arts, along with the development of technology awareness and of adequate applications in the fields of theatrology, education and lifelong learning. Viewing everything through this frame of perspective, this MA program aims not only at research development but also at the specialization of the participants, both scholars, artists and animators.

The DPAELL in Nafplion is the first one in Greece which cultivates knowledge and theatre-paedagogical skills and also retains its theoretical/ artistic dimension. Upon the announcement of its commencement (Summer 2014) and within 15 days, 109 candidates submitted their applications, thirty-two of which were successfully selected and were given the chance to register and to attend the graduate courses and workshops every weekend. The novelty of DPAELL is that the courses are not taught only by the faculty of the Department of Theatre Studies, but also by faculty of other universities and by specialists in the fields of drama, theatre, drama therapy, cinema, adult education, music, dance, lighting, creative writing, cross-cultural  or intercultural education and other relevant specialties from all over Greece.

The graduate students, even from the very start of their studies, conducted research, sometimes relevant to the wider area of Argolida, its people and the culture developed within its borders. They also organised a lot of theatrical workshops for children, presented books on the art of drama in education-which they, themselves, narrated fairy tales that the same had written (Fairy Tale Marathon every year) and acquainted the public with outstanding individuals from Argolida. During their second semester , they continued the events which focused not only on teenagers, babies and elderly people but also on puppet shows (Puppet Festival) and videos. The events took place in co-operation with the Municipality of Nafplio and other cultural institutions such as the Archaeological Museum, the Gate of Culture ( Pyli Politismou ), the Centres of Environmental Education of N. Kios and of Lithakia ( Zakynthos) , and mostly with Fougaro, the place of art and life at nafpplio.. Furthermore, the DPAELL students gained access to e-publishing, thus creating - apart from the Net Page (site) of the Department (ts.uop.gr Postgraduate Studies)- their own Website on Facebook (Μεταπτυχιακό Πρόγραμμα Σπουδών- Τμήμα Θεατρικών Σπουδών- Ναύπλιο) with more than 100,000 visitors in the last trimester, and an e-paper called "Theatronio N30". Last but not least, they occasionally collaborate with sites based in Nafplio -and regularly with Argonafplia.gr.

The DPAELL is coordinated by Dr. Asterios Tsiaras, who is Associate Professor and Vice Rector for Academic & Student Affairs at the University of the Peloponnese and also by the support of Alkistis Kondyianni, who mainly is responsible for prison education at Tirynth and Nafplio Prisons, in which the master gives a lot of attention and practice every year, since 2015.
